Set in the fall of 1980, isolated mute Alice comes upon a startling discovery that her father may be a serial killer... A sharp read for lovers of true crime and Bright Young Women by Jessica Knoll.

Set in the fall of 1980, isolated mute Alice comes upon a startling discovery that her father may be a serial killer... A sharp read for lovers of true crime and Bright Young Women by Jessica Knoll.

Born mute, twenty-two year-old Alice has never known a normal life. Kept from the outside world by her cruel mother and overbearing father, her only friend is her neighbour Hailey with whom she communicates through sign language.

When Alice's father is diagnosed with terminal cancer, Alice must attend and care for him, all the while listening to his feverish drug-induced ramblings. That is until, in his final days, he reveals something Alice never expected. He confesses to murdering several women.

Shocked and disbelieving, Alice confides in Hailey. Together, they vow to find the truth and decide to journey her father's old routes as a travelling salesman. A pattern begins to emerge, connecting him to various missing women, before the pair discovers the real reason why Alice lost her ability to speak. And how she is at the centre of her father's crimes...
